I had this one very colorfull photo taken by my husband at a past CHA show in Anaheim. I wanted this layout to be funky and girly and for this project I found the Core Impression Cardstock by Core’dinations to be perfect.

I sanded the pre embossed cardstock with the Sand it Gadget – also from Core’dinations, and I love how the teal color was revealed under the black cardstock. It was like magic :-)

As you can see on the borders and on the close up – I used some Photo corners – Polypropylene in Black as embellishments on this page. I love how they also add texture to the overall project.

With my MyStik Permanent Strips Dispenser in hand, I put the entire layout together in no time.
